AN APPLIED STUDY ON COMPARING PIGMENT AND DYESTUFF IN FINE PAPER

In the production of fine paper, the shade is one of the important properties. The fine paper shade and its colour matching technique were studied in this paper. The combination of dyes/FWAs and pigments/FWAs were used in the process of tinting fine paper. The results showed that two combinations could reach the same effect and higher shade was obtained by using the combination of pigments/FWAs in high brightness fine paper (CIE=155).The optimal dosage of dyes/FWAs was direct violet 0.12kg/t (on oven dried pulp), direct blue0.08 kg/t (on oven dried pulp), FWA11 kg/t and the optimal dosage of pigments/FWAs was pigment violet 0.2 kg/t(on oven dried pulp), pigment blue0.03 kg/t (on oven dried pulp), FWA7.5 kg/t (on oven dried pulp).The cost of tinting decreased as the dosage of FWAs reduced.
